Cool prints! How do I get the dark paint to stay on the plate under the stencil and not be lifted off when I remove the stencil? It only leaves a halo effect.
In my experience you need a pretty viscous acrylic for the under layer. A heavy body or medium body with a good amount of squishyness (not a word..I know) Also, work fairly quickly. I have had the under paint dry to fast and stick to the stencil before as well. Just keep trying different paints and practicing until you find the right combo :)
Shel C ok, Thanks! I tried with Liquitex Basics and it stuck to the stencil. Next is going to be Lukas Akryl.
